• Negin Asr Rehabilitation Centre started its activities in Mashad city in 1995 and still continuing its program. • In 1997 Vali-Asr Comprehensive Rehabilitation Centre was established in Tehran for providing clinical rehabilitation services for children with cerebral palsy and mentally retarded children. It was one of the earliest centers in this field inaugurated under the name of Navid Asr rehabilitation centre and located in Tehran, its activities have now been transferred to this new centre. • In 1998, the branch of Vali-Asr Rehabilitation Foundation was set up in Kashan city for screening neurological problems in new born babies. Now Negar Asr Comprehensive Rehabilitation Centre provides rehabilitation services for high risk babies and children under 6 years old with physical and mental disabilities in a new constructed building. • In 2003, Vali Asr Foundation started its activities In Shiraz city by establishing Forough Asr Comprehensive Rehabilitation Centre. This center like the other VRF centers provides high standard rehabilitation services. • In 2005, Navid Asr Comprehensive Rehabilitation centre started its activities for needy children of central and southern parts of Tehran. • In 2005, Omid Asr Comprehensive Rehabilitations Centre was inaugurated and aimed at utilizing new techniques and approaches in the rehabilitation of neurologically disabled children. This centre is also active in the field of monitoring child development and Learning Disabilities with great success. in addition to providing clinical rehabilitation services, these two centre also provide, special professional services for CP children. The rehabilitation services are for children with developmental delays, physically and mentally disabled children and school students (first and second grade), daycare services (under 6 years old) and vocational skills training (above 14 years). • In the past two years one of the important investment of the VRF was capacity building in its activities domin. A great investment was also done in introducing new techniques such as Conductive Education (CE) and Adeli Suit and organizing related training courses both inside and outside the country. The benefits can be observed in all VRF clinic services. These new approaches in services provision are most welcome by disabled families and at the same time disabled children of neighbo uring countries are also referred to these rehabilitation services. • In order to promote a positive image of disabled people, and changing the negative attitude towards them, practical action was taken by investing in a film production .
